## Authentication

The Frostbin archiver moves cold storage buckets into Glacierline via the internal VaultGate API. Releases must ship with a valid VaultGate key baked into the deploy manifest — no key, no archive run. Keys rotate each release cycle; the release manager owns the swap. Scope is archive-write only. The current cycle's key follows.

service key, kahif-tajeg: vxb2-8j

## Runbook: SQL lint enforcement

All SQL files under `warehouse/` must pass `sqlward lint` before merge. Reviewers should reject changes that disable rules inline without a linked exception ticket; common offenders are the keyword-casing and implicit-join checks. To pull the current ruleset from the Lintvault config service during a local run, authenticate with the key below.

service key, fawip-bajef: kto11_Qt5wZK9vdNC

Subject: FY Headcount Plan — Executive Summary

Team, attached thinking for next year's headcount at Orvane Analytics. We propose adding six roles to field sales in the Hestwick territory, holding support flat, and deferring the two marketing hires until the Cardale launch confirms demand. Sales leads should review territory coverage assumptions carefully before Friday's session, as backfill timing depends on attrition forecasts that remain uncertain. One element is not for wider circulation, and the confidential note follows below.

management briefing: Project Ulavan slips by two quarters because of the staffing delay.

# Break-Glass: Catalog Cache Invalidation

Scope: the Pinrow product catalog at Veldstone Retail. If stale prices persist after a purge and the Hollowmere invalidation queue is wedged, use break-glass to flush the edge tier directly. Contractors: get verbal sign-off from the catalog lead first. Steps: open the Hollowmere admin shell, select emergency-flush, confirm the tenant, and run it once — repeated flushes thrash the origin. Access is logged and expires after 20 minutes. Unseal the admin shell with the passphrase below.

recovery phrase for kahop-tajog: istix-casvan